Is « clone » masculine or feminine?
« clone » is masculine. You say le clone.
Article forms
| With the definite article | le clone |
| With the indefinite article | un clone |
| With the partitive article | du clone |
Plural
The plural is clones (les clones). A noun keeps its gender in the plural; only the article stops showing it.
